# 0.32.0

> Smithers 0.32.0 adds monitor workflows that watch and heal runs, task-shaped oneshot routing, release review automation, safer workflow recovery, and a broad child-run durability hardening pass.

**Smithers 0.32.0 is a durability and operations release.** Most changes target
the places durable runs break in production: resumed runs, child workflows,
sandboxed networks, monitors, and time travel. It also adds task-shaped
oneshot routing, a release-review workflow, monitor workflows that can heal a
run, and a resume path that accepts an edited workflow instead of refusing to
continue.

## Task-shaped oneshots and release review

`smithers oneshot` now chooses its first available model from the goal shape.
UI and frontend goals lead with Kimi K3, while general implementation goals
lead with Claude Opus 5. Explicit `--agent` and `--model` choices still win,
and `smithers oneshot --status` reports the resolved task type and chain.

The built-in pack also gains `review-since-publish`, a three-model review panel
that compares the working tree with the last published tag, merges verified
findings, partitions fixes into file-disjoint lanes, and repeats until clean.

## Monitor workflows: a workflow that watches your workflow

Long runs fail in boring ways: a node wedges, an agent stalls, and nobody is
watching at 3am. Now you can ship a monitor alongside any workflow. Drop a
file at `.smithers/monitor/<workflowId>.tsx` and Smithers runs it against
every run of that workflow: it observes health, applies the healing actions
you define for stalled or wedged-node conditions, and escalates to a durable
`HumanTask` when it cannot fix things itself.

* Healing actions are ordinary workflow code, so a monitor can retry a node,
  resume a parked run, or gather diagnostics before waking you.
* Escalations are durable human requests, so the question survives restarts
  and shows up in `bunx smithers-orchestrator human` and the Monitor UI.
* This is a first release of the surface; expect the condition vocabulary to
  grow in coming versions.

## Resume a run whose workflow you edited

Editing a workflow file while one of its runs was parked used to be a dead
end: resuming failed with `RESUME_METADATA_MISMATCH` and your only option was
forking a fresh run. Now you decide:

```bash theme={"theme":{"light":"github-light","dark":"github-dark"}}
bunx smithers-orchestrator retry-task RUN_ID TASK_ID --accept-workflow-change
bunx smithers-orchestrator up --resume RUN_ID --accept-workflow-change
```

* The run carries the edited workflow forward from the resume point.
* The mismatch error now names the flag, so the fix is in the message.

## The CLI watcher speaks up sooner

`smithers claude monitor` used to alert only on discrete bad transitions, so a
run that was quietly retrying the same node forever, or emitting nothing at
all, never broke the silence. It now fires on retry churn (`node-retrying`)
and on long silence from a live run (`run-progress`), so a wedged detached run
pings you instead of wasting an afternoon.

Oneshots got the same attention: `smithers monitor <runId>` now serves a
dedicated live UI for built-in oneshots where you can watch the transcript and
steer the agent mid-run. The oneshot and hijack surfaces now share one
`OneshotSurface` component, so steering works the same everywhere.

## Right-sized authoring and honest review verdicts

Two authoring-loop fixes reduce wasted runs:

* `create-workflow` now right-sizes the request before building anything. A
  trivial edit is routed directly, a well-scoped goal goes to
  `smithers oneshot`, and only genuinely multi-stage work gets a full
  workflow scaffold.
* Review verdicts now distinguish `blocked` (the verification could not run
  for an environmental reason, such as a missing service) from
  `approved: false` (a real rejection). Harness faults no longer read as
  rejected work.

`smithers oneshot` also warns when the working copy is dirty and has the agent
triage the leftover changes before starting on your goal, instead of silently
building on top of them.

## Durability hardening

This is where much of the release's hardening work went.

* **Async `deps` callbacks complete when they finish, not before.** A
  `<Task deps>` async function child could be claimed complete while its
  work, including a launched child run, was still pending, so downstream
  tasks read an empty payload. The engine now awaits the callback before
  claiming completion (#1415).
* **Child runs behave like part of the run.** A large batch of subflow fixes
  landed: cancel and pause now propagate to child runs, approvals keep the
  right owner, signals are preserved across child waits (#1405), snapshot
  lineage stays isolated, failed child branches all reset on retry (#1410),
  subflow rewind leases are hardened (#1411), and child runs keep gateway
  attribution (#1389) and appear in run lists.
* **Time travel restores real bytes.** jj attempt pointers recorded the
  change id, and since jj resolves a change id to its current commit,
  `revert` and `timetravel` could resolve to the very state you were trying
  to leave: a silent filesystem no-op. Pointers now pin the immutable commit
  id.
* **The network sandbox keeps loopback open.** `allowNetwork: false` was
  cutting off local dev servers, local Postgres, and unix sockets along with
  the internet. Loopback now stays reachable while remote egress is still
  denied, and denial errors name the `--allow-network` escape hatch.
* **Evals stop blaming your workflow for harness deaths.** A red case whose
  failure matches a harness signature (network, DNS, OOM, rate limit) is now
  graded INCONCLUSIVE instead of failed, and `bunx smithers-orchestrator eval` exits with code
  5 when every red case is inconclusive, so CI can retry instead of
  reverting good work.
* **Subflow timers wake durably.** Parent subflows now persist their child
  timer deadline, close stale waiting attempts, and resume through the gateway
  timer sweep instead of parking forever.
* **Event waits reject stale matches.** A new wait cannot consume an older
  matching signal that predates the wait node.

## Other improvements

* Gateway RPC, REST, SDK, and MCP surfaces gained typed queries for a run's
  child-run descendants and direct children, with regenerated contracts and
  docs (#1391).
* New `packages/ui-core` and `packages/tui-ui` packages extract the shared
  runs domain (run list, tree, event frames, health, and view models) used by
  both the TUI and the web UI.
* The approval panel gained accessibility improvements, loading skeletons,
  and richer decision feedback.
* A new `eval-driven-development` skill documents red-classify-first,
  green-ratchet, and circuit-breaker discipline for automated repair loops.
* Dependency ranges widened for effect, zod, and pglite, and mermaid is now
  an optional peer dependency.
* New docs: capability pages, a monitor workflows guide, and a compatibility
  policy page.
* Whole Foods ordering webhooks must match the server-configured HTTPS
  endpoint and resolve only to public addresses, closing input-driven SSRF and
  redirect paths.
* The TUI run search now captures printable keys without triggering global
  shortcuts, and unknown backend statuses stay out of active-run counts.

## Upgrade notes

* If a resumed run previously failed with `RESUME_METADATA_MISMATCH` after an
  in-flight workflow edit, re-run with `retry-task --accept-workflow-change`
  (or `up --resume --accept-workflow-change`) instead of forking a fresh run.
* Workflows using `<Task deps>` with async function children should confirm
  downstream consumers were not silently reading an empty `{}` payload before
  this release; the compute bridge now awaits the callback before claiming
  completion.
* Sandboxed tasks with `allowNetwork: false` can now reach loopback services.
  If you relied on loopback being blocked, that is no longer the case.
* `bunx smithers-orchestrator eval` can now exit with code 5 (all red cases inconclusive).
  CI scripts that treat any nonzero exit as a regression should handle it as
  a retry signal.
